Claude Code 对接 Kimi API 详细教程

AI 概述
本文针对国内用户无法正常使用Claude Code的问题,提供通过修改配置文件对接Kimi API的解决方案。教程包含Claude Code安装、全局与项目级配置、Kimi API密钥获取、启动验证等步骤,同时给出常用命令、快捷键及认证失败、模型错误等常见问题排查方法,可实现用Kimi替代Claude服务进行AI编程。
目录
文章目录隐藏
  1. 一、安装 Claude Code
  2. 二、初始配置
  3. 三、配置 Kimi API
  4. 四、获取 Kimi API Key
  5. 五、启动 Claude Code
  6. 六、常用命令与快捷键
  7. 七、常见问题解答 (FAQ)
  8. 八、进阶配置
  9. 结语

Claude Code 对接 Kimi API 详细教程

国内用户常因网络与 API 限制,导致无法正常使用 Claude Code 编程助手。本文提供一套实用方案:通过修改配置文件,将 Claude Code 对接 Kimi API,实现用 Kimi 模型替代 Claude 官方服务。全文包含安装、配置、密钥获取、启动验证及常见问题排查,步骤清晰可直接照做。本文将详细介绍整个配置过程。

一、安装 Claude Code

1.1 官方文档

首先访问 Claude Code 官方文档了解基本信息:

官网链接:点击这里

1.2 一键安装

根据你的操作系统,选择对应的安装命令:

macOS / Linux / WSL

curl -fsSL https://claude.ai/install.sh | bash

Windows PowerShell

irm https://claude.ai/install.ps1 | iex

注意如果下载失败,请检查网络连接,或者尝试使用其他网络工具。

1.3 验证安装

安装完成后,在终端输入以下命令验证:

claude --version

二、初始配置

2.1 首次启动

在目标项目文件夹内执行:

claude

首次启动会引导你进行配置:

  1. 颜色外观配置 – 选择你喜欢的主题风格;
  2. API 配置 – Claude 官方提供的三种方式都不支持 Kimi,所以我们需要跳过此步骤。

2.2 退出初始配置

由于官方配置不支持 Kimi API,直接按 两次 Ctrl+C 退出 Claude Code,然后手动修改配置文件。

三、配置 Kimi API

3.1 找到配置文件

Claude Code 的配置文件位于用户主目录下:

  • macOS/Linux~/.claude.json
  • Windows%USERPROFILE%\.claude.json

3.2 编辑配置文件

使用你喜欢的编辑器打开配置文件:

# macOS/Linux
nano ~/.claude.json
# 或使用 VS Code
code ~/.claude.json

3.3 添加 Kimi API 配置

在配置文件中添加以下 env 配置段:

{
  "env": {
    "ANTHROPIC_BASE_URL": "https://api.kimi.com/coding/",
    "ANTHROPIC_AUTH_TOKEN": "sk-kimi-xxxxx",
    "ANTHROPIC_MODEL": "kimi-k2.5",
    "ANTHROPIC_SMALL_FAST_MODEL": "kimi-k2.5",
    "CLAUDE_CODE_DISABLE_NONESSENTIAL_TRAFFIC": "1",
    "API_TIMEOUT_MS": "600000"
  }
}

3.4 配置项说明

配置项 说明 建议值
ANTHROPIC_BASE_URL Kimi API 的基础地址 https://api.kimi.com/coding/
ANTHROPIC_AUTH_TOKEN 你的 Kimi API Key 从 Kimi 开放平台获取
ANTHROPIC_MODEL 主要使用的模型 kimi-k2.5
ANTHROPIC_SMALL_FAST_MODEL 快速响应模型 kimi-k2.5
CLAUDE_CODE_DISABLE_NONESSENTIAL_TRAFFIC 禁用非必要流量 1
API_TIMEOUT_MS API 超时时间(毫秒) 600000 (10 分钟)

四、获取 Kimi API Key

4.1 注册 Kimi 开放平台账号

  1. 访问 Kimi 开放平台
  2. 使用手机号或邮箱注册账号
  3. 完成实名认证(如需)

4.2 创建 API Key

  1. 登录后进入控制台
  2. 点击左侧菜单「API Key 管理」
  3. 点击「创建 API Key」
  4. 复制生成的 sk- 开头的密钥

重要:API Key 只会显示一次,请务必妥善保存!

4.3 充值(如需)

Kimi API 采用按量计费模式:

  • 新用户通常有免费额度
  • 可在「账户管理」中查看余额和充值

五、启动 Claude Code

5.1 在项目目录中启动

# 进入你的项目文件夹
cd /path/to/your/project
# 启动 Claude Code
claude

5.2 验证连接

成功启动后,你会看到类似以下的提示:

╭──────────────────────────────────────────────────────────────╮
│ ✻ Welcome to Claude Code!                                   │
│                                                              │
│ Model: kimi-k2.5                                            │
│ Current directory: /path/to/your/project                    │
╰──────────────────────────────────────────────────────────────╯

如果显示 kimi-k2.5 模型,说明配置成功!

六、常用命令与快捷键

6.1 基础命令

命令 说明
claude 在当前目录启动 Claude Code
claude --help 查看帮助信息
claude --version 查看版本号

6.2 交互快捷键

快捷键 功能
Ctrl+C 取消当前操作 / 退出
Ctrl+D 退出 Claude Code
Tab 自动补全
↑/↓ 浏览历史输入

6.3 特殊指令

在 Claude Code 交互界面中,可以使用以下指令:

  • /help – 显示帮助;
  • /clear – 清空对话历史;
  • /cost – 查看本次会话的 API 消耗。

七、常见问题解答 (FAQ)

Q1: 提示 “Authentication failed”

原因:API Key 无效或过期

解决

  1. 检查~/.claude.json中的ANTHROPIC_AUTH_TOKEN是否正确;
  2. 确认 API Key 没有过期;
  3. 尝试重新生成 API Key。

Q2: 提示 “Model not found”

原因:模型名称配置错误

解决:确认 ANTHROPIC_MODEL 设置为 kimi-k2.5 或其他 Kimi 支持的模型

Q3: 响应速度很慢

原因:可能是网络问题或模型负载高

解决

  1. 检查网络连接;
  2. 尝试调整 API_TIMEOUT_MS 为更大的值;
  3. 避开使用高峰期。

Q4: 如何查看 API 调用费用?

解决:登录 Kimi 开放平台,在「账户管理」中查看消费记录。

Q5: Claude Code 更新后配置失效

原因:更新可能重置了配置。

解决:重新编辑 ~/.claude.json 文件,确保配置正确。

八、进阶配置

8.1 配置多个项目

Claude Code 支持在项目根目录创建 .claude.json 文件,实现项目级配置:

{
  "env": {
    "ANTHROPIC_MODEL": "kimi-k2.5"
  }
}

项目级配置会覆盖全局配置。

8.2 使用不同的 Kimi 模型

Kimi 提供多个模型版本,可根据需求选择:

模型 适用场景
kimi-k2.5 通用场景,平衡速度与质量
kimi-k1.5 需要推理能力的复杂任务
moonshot-v1-8k 短文本快速处理

8.3 代理配置(如需)

如果需要通过代理访问,可添加:

{
  "env": {
    "HTTP_PROXY": "http://127.0.0.1:7890",
    "HTTPS_PROXY": "http://127.0.0.1:7890"
  }
}

结语

我们通过替换 API 地址与密钥,让 Claude Code 可以顺利接入 Kimi 大模型,满足了国内开发者的 AI 编程需求。按上面教程配置完成后就可以正常执行代码生成、项目重构等任务,然后配合项目级配置与代理设置,能进一步适配不同场景。在使用期间如果遇到认证、超时等问题,按 FAQ 排查即可稳定使用。

以上关于Claude Code 对接 Kimi API 详细教程的文章就介绍到这了,更多相关内容请搜索码云笔记以前的文章或继续浏览下面的相关文章,希望大家以后多多支持码云笔记。

「点点赞赏,手留余香」

20

给作者打赏,鼓励TA抓紧创作!

微信微信 支付宝支付宝

还没有人赞赏,快来当第一个赞赏的人吧!

声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如若内容造成侵权/违法违规/事实不符,请将相关资料发送至 admin@mybj123.com 进行投诉反馈,一经查实,立即处理!
重要:如软件存在付费、会员、充值等,均属软件开发者或所属公司行为,与本站无关,网友需自行判断
码云笔记 » Claude Code 对接 Kimi API 详细教程

发表回复